3. Description:
The Archive::Tar module provides a mechanism for Perl scripts to manipulate tar archive files.
Multiple directory traversal flaws were discovered in the Archive::Tar module. A specially-crafted tar file could cause a Perl script, using the Archive::Tar module to extract the archive, to overwrite an arbitrary file writable by the user running the script. (CVE-2007-4829)
This package upgrades the Archive::Tar module to version 1.39_01. Refer to the Archive::Tar module's changes file, linked to in the References, for a full list of changes.
Users of perl-Archive-Tar are advised to upgrade to this updated package, which corrects these issues. All applications using the Archive::Tar module must be restarted for this update to take effect.
